The speaker begins by establishing that while AI and machine learning packages can abstract away much of the underlying mathematics [], a foundational understanding is crucial for debugging, interpreting model behavior, and optimizing algorithms effectively []. He highlights three core mathematical areas: statistics and probability, linear algebra, and calculus []. Within statistics, key concepts include understanding populations and sampling, measures of central tendency (mean, median, mode), variance, the central limit theorem, conditional probability, Bayes' theorem, maximum likelihood estimation, and regression techniques [-].
